CW Renews 'Riverdale', 'Legacies', 'Black Lightning', 'The Flash' & More For New Seasons

The CW is bringing back all of their current shows!

While Arrow and Supernatural are signing off this season, along with The 100, the network announced today that new shows Batwoman and Nancy Drew will be back for new seasons for the 2020-2021 season.

The Flash, Riverdale, DC’s Legends of Tomorrow, Black Lightning, Supergirl, All American, Charmed, Dynasty, In the Dark, Legacies and Roswell, New Mexico were also picked up for additional seasons on the network.

The only show left out was Katy Keene, a spinoff of Riverdale.

However, the show starring Lucy Hale, was given 13 additional scripts for it’s freshman season.

The CW Announces Midseason Premiere Dates for Riverdale, Arrow, Supernatural, & More

The CW has revealed its winter premiere dates for some of your favorite shows!

The network has announced dates for series like Riverdale, Arrow, Supernatural, and more.

Nancy Drew returns first, on January 15 at 9/8c, and Supernatural‘s final season returns on January 16 at 8/7c.

Arrow kicks off its final episodes post-Crisis on Infinite Earths crossover on January 21 at 8/7c. The season five premiere of DC’s Legends of Tomorrow follows at 9 p.m. The Flash returns on February 4.

Melissa Benoist & 'Supergirl' Cast Hit 100 Episode Milestone!

Melissa Benoist takes the center spot in this group photo of the cast and crew of Supergirl at their 100th episode celebration held at Fairmont Pacific Rim Hotel on Saturday night (December 14) in Vancouver, Canada.

The 31-year-old actress was joined at the event by current and past co-stars including Chyler Leigh, David Harewood, Katie McGrath, Andrea Brooks, and Elizabeth Tulloch.

Also in attendance were Melissa‘s husband and former cast mate Chris Wood, cast members Jesse Rath, Nicole Maines, Julie Gonzalo, Staz Nair, and Azie Tesfai, as well as Executive Producer Greg Berlanti, President of Warner Bros Television Peter Roth, and CW Network President Mark Pedowitz.

Supergirl‘s 100th episode will be season five’s upcoming 13th episode, which is set to air in February 2020.

'Crisis On Infinite Earths' Begins Tonight & We Have A New Sneak Peek - Watch Now!

The Arrowverse stars gather for a meeting on Earth 38 for a meeting in the first part of the Crisis On Infinite Earths crossover event, beginning TONIGHT (December 8)!

In “Part One”, The Monitor (LaMonica Garrett) sends Harbinger (Audrey Marie Anderson) to gather the worlds’ greatest heroes – Supergirl (Melissa Benoist), The Flash (Grant Gustin), Green Arrow (Stephen Amell), Batwoman (Ruby Rose), White Canary (Caity Lotz), The Atom (Brandon Routh) and Superman (Tyler Hoechlin) – in preparation for the impending Crisis.

With their worlds in imminent danger, the superheroes suit up for battle while J’onn (David Harewood) and Alex (Chyler Leigh) recruit Lena (Katie McGrath) to help them find a way to save the people of Earth-38.

Crisis on Infinite Earths will span over five Arrowverse shows, including Supergirl, The Flash, Arrow, Batwoman and Legends of Tomorrow. It will also feature three different Supermans and an appearance from Black Lightning‘s Cress Williams.

Barry Tells Iris It's Time For Him To Die In 'Crisis On Infinite Earths' Extended Trailer - Watch Now!

The full, extended trailer for the upcoming Crisis On Infinite Earths is showing a lot more at what’s to come!

In the new video, Barry (Grant Gustin) is ready to give up and tells Iris (Candace Patton) that it’s “time for me to die.”

Another part of the trailer sees Oliver (Stephen Amell) telling Mia (Katherine McNamara) to “find your mother, tell her how much I love her.”

Crisis on Infinite Earths will span over five Arrowverse shows, including Supergirl, The Flash, Arrow, Batwoman and Legends of Tomorrow. It will also feature three different Supermans and an appearance from Black Lightning‘s Cress Williams.

Melissa Benoist Makes Startling Announcement as Kara Danvers on 'Supergirl' Set

SPOILERS AHEAD!!!!

Kara Danvers is tired of hiding!

It looks like she’s revealing exactly who she is in these set pics from the Supergirl set.

Melissa Benoist was seen showing off her super suit underneath her clothes to a crowd of reporters while filming for the series in Vancouver, Canada on Monday (December 2).
